The position falls within the transmission department of the organization. The engineer will be working with sr engineers to complete projects that support our utility customer. They will work with in-house and client engineers and designers.
Primary Duties and Responsibilities
- Responsible for the engineering and design activities related to transmission line design such as engineering analysis and design, route selection, material acquisition, structural and foundation design, and project and construction management
- Prepare project construction documents such as: plan and profile drawings; design drawings; engineering, material, and construction specifications; project schedules and bills of material
- Develop project design alternatives and corresponding cost estimates
- Design new transmission facilities with voltages ranging from 12 kV and 765 kV
- Utilize PLS-CADD to model transmission line design project.
- Conduct contractor bid and construction meetings and assist in ensuring that work activities are performed safely and in accordance with plans and established schedules, and in accordance with AEP policies, rules and standards, and in compliance with external regulations
- Coordinate effectively with governmental and regulatory agencies and contractors to secure project permit
- Provide leadership to facilitate project completion, to train and mentor other engineers, and to develop measurable work area goals and objectives
- Function as a project lead for transmission projects
- Coordinate work activities of others within the work group and department to complete transmission projects
- Provide training and guidance to lower-level employees
- Initiate corrective action when substation project objectives are not being met
- Work under supervision of higher-level engineers
- Position will require occasional site visits
Additional
Skills & Qualifications
- Two to five years of experience in utilities working with Transmission Line Design
- Two to five years of experience completing engineering projects from start to finish
- Two to five years of experience scoping, estimating, and ordering materials for Transmission Lines projects
- Bachelor's Degree in Civil Engineering or Electrical Engineering (ABET)
- Master's Degree in Civil Engineering or Electrical Engineering (ABET) will count toward years of experience
- An EIT License is desirable but not required
